Maintenance Officer / Handyman
The Wonthaggi Workers Club is one of the most loved venues in town — a proper local institution. And you're the person who keeps it running. If something's broken, you fix it. If something looks tired, you sort it out. If a tradie's coming in, you're the one meeting them at the door.
This is a hands-on role at one of Wonthaggi's busiest venues. You'll look after the buildings, the grounds, the equipment — basically everything that makes the club feel the way it should for the members and guests who've been walking through those doors for years. No two days look the same, and that's what makes it a good gig.
What you'll be doing
Day to day, you'll handle general repairs and maintenance across the venue — inside and out. That includes the gardens, car parks, service areas, fixtures, and fittings. You'll keep on top of preventative maintenance schedules while also jumping on urgent jobs when they come up.
You'll do basic plumbing work, help with stock deliveries and manual handling tasks, and make sure cleaning and presentation standards are where they need to be. When external trades or contractors are on-site, you're the go-to person coordinating the work.
What you'll bring
Experience in commercial building or facilities maintenance is a must. You know your way around tools, plant, and equipment, and you take safety seriously. A current Victorian driver's licence is essential.
You're the kind of person who sees a problem and just gets on with it — no hand-holding needed. You take pride in how a place looks and runs, and you're comfortable managing your own priorities day to day.
A trade qualification is a bonus but not a dealbreaker. Basic computer skills and decent written communication round things out.
